CARNE ASADA FRIES from san diego, california
CARNE ASADA FRIES from san diego, california is a medium Mexican-American recipe that serves 4. 820 calories per serving. Recipe by Tim Laielli on YouTube.

Ingredients
- 4 Russet Potatoes (peeled and cut into 1/4‑inch sticks)
- 4 cups Vegetable Oil (for deep‑frying, high smoke point)
- 1 pound Flank Steak (trimmed, sliced thin against the grain)
- 2 tablespoons Lime Juice (freshly squeezed)
- 2 cloves Garlic (minced)
- 2 tablespoons Cilantro (chopped, plus extra for garnish)
- 1 teaspoon Ground Cumin
- 1 cup Mexican Blend Cheese (shredded)
- 1 cup Guacamole (store‑bought or homemade)
- 1 cup Pico de Gallo (fresh tomato‑onion‑cilantro salsa)
- 1/2 cup Sour Cream
Instructions
Prepare the Potatoes
Rinse the cut potato sticks, pat dry thoroughly, and set aside on a paper towel to remove excess moisture.
Time: PT5M
Marinate the Steak
In a mixing bowl combine flank steak strips with lime juice, minced garlic, chopped cilantro, ground cumin, and a pinch of salt. Toss to coat and let rest while you heat the oil.
Time: PT5M
Heat Oil for Frying
Fill a deep fryer or heavy pot with 4 cups vegetable oil and heat to 350°F (175°C). Use a thermometer to check temperature.
Time: PT5M
Temperature: 350°F
Fry the Potatoes
Working in batches, carefully lower potato sticks into hot oil. Fry until golden and crisp, about 4‑5 minutes per batch. Remove with tongs and drain on paper towels.
Time: PT10M
Temperature: 350°F
Cook the Carne Asada
While fries are draining, preheat a cast‑iron skillet over high heat. Add a thin drizzle of oil, then spread the marinated steak in a single layer. Sear 2‑3 minutes per side until medium‑rare (internal temp 130‑135°F), then remove and slice into bite‑size pieces.
Time: PT8M
Assemble the Loaded Fries
Spread the hot fries on a large serving platter or baking sheet. Sprinkle shredded Mexican blend cheese over the top, then scatter the sliced carne asada. Return to the oven at 400°F for 2 minutes just to melt the cheese.
Time: PT2M
Temperature: 400°F
Add Fresh Toppings
Top the cheesy fries with dollops of guacamole, pico de gallo, and sour cream. Garnish with extra cilantro and a squeeze of lime if desired.
